KATO DEFEATS KUMANO


June 24, 2009

TOKYO, JAPAN

Japanese top ranked lightweight Yoshitaka Kato (17-2-1, 5 KOs), 135, a short and tough John Brown stylist, eked out a majority decision (78-75, 77-75 and 77-77) over JBC#8 Kazuyoshi Kumano (22-8, 5 KOs), 135, over eight give-and-take rounds on Wednesday in Tokyo, Japan. Kato displayed his trademark left hooks to take the initiative in the first half, almost stunning the taller and durable Kumano in the fourth. Katofs lack of defense made him a stationary target of Kumanofs retaliation in later rounds. Kato wishes to avenge his previous defeat by Ryuji Migaki, current national 135-pound champ, in a rematch with his belt at stake, but had better improve his defensive skills.

Promoter: Kadoebi Jewel Promotions.
